Sir Arthur Stewart-Liberty, a major landowner in the parish of The Lee, Bucks, had a close business connection through his Regent Street retail business with Moorcroft pottery. After the war and Sir Arthur's death in 1917, Lady Liberty commissioned the manufacture of special commemorative mugs. These were signed by Lady Liberty and given to members of The Lee parish.
